使用DataGrip创建MySQL Schema与表

作者:公子世无双2024.04.01 19:08浏览量:42

简介:本文将指导您如何使用DataGrip这款流行的数据库工具来创建MySQL的Schema以及在该Schema下创建表。我们将简要介绍DataGrip的界面,并详细解释每个步骤,确保即使是初学者也能轻松上手。

使用DataGrip创建MySQL Schema与表

DataGrip是JetBrains公司出品的一款数据库IDE,支持多种数据库系统,包括MySQL。通过DataGrip,您可以方便地管理数据库,包括创建Schema、表、视图、索引等。下面,我们将详细介绍如何使用DataGrip来创建MySQL的Schema以及在该Schema下创建表。

1. 打开DataGrip并连接到MySQL数据库

首先,打开DataGrip,然后点击左上角的“+”按钮来添加新的数据源。在数据源列表中选择MySQL,然后填写您的数据库连接信息,包括主机名、端口、用户名、密码等。点击“Test Connection”测试连接,如果一切正常,点击“OK”保存连接信息。

2. 创建Schema

在DataGrip中,Schema通常对应于数据库中的一个命名空间,它包含了表、视图、索引等数据库对象。要创建一个新的Schema,您可以按照以下步骤操作:

  • 在数据库连接节点上右键点击,选择“New” -> “Schema”。
  • 在弹出的对话框中,输入Schema的名称,然后点击“OK”。

这样,一个新的Schema就在您的MySQL数据库中创建成功了。

3. 在Schema下创建表

创建好Schema后,您可以在该Schema下创建表。请按照以下步骤操作:

  • 在刚刚创建的Schema上右键点击,选择“New” -> “Table”。
  • 在弹出的对话框中,您可以开始定义表的结构。您可以添加字段(列),并设置每个字段的数据类型、是否允许为空、默认值等属性。
  • 例如,我们要创建一个名为users的表,包含idusernamepassword三个字段。对于id字段,我们可以设置其数据类型为INT,并设置为主键、自增;对于usernamepassword字段,我们可以设置其数据类型为VARCHAR(255),并允许为空。
  • 定义完表结构后,点击“OK”按钮,DataGrip将自动生成创建表的SQL语句,并执行该语句,从而在数据库中创建表。

4. 查看和管理表

创建表后,您可以在DataGrip的左侧导航栏中看到新创建的表。您可以双击表名,查看表的数据,也可以右键点击表名,进行各种管理操作,如编辑表结构、导出数据、删除表等。

5. 注意事项

  • 在创建Schema和表时,要确保您有相应的权限。
  • 在定义表结构时,要根据实际需求来设置字段的数据类型、是否允许为空等属性。
  • 在执行任何数据库操作时,都要谨慎操作,以免误删或误改数据。

总结

通过以上步骤,您已经学会了如何使用DataGrip来创建MySQL的Schema和表。DataGrip作为一款强大的数据库IDE,不仅提供了丰富的数据库管理功能,还具有简洁易用的界面和强大的性能。通过熟练掌握DataGrip的使用,您将能够更加高效地进行数据库开发和管理工作。